Operating Systems Purchased Separately
If you purchased your operating system separately, you must install it using
the SmartStart CD. Refer to the Server Setup and Management pack for
instructions on using SmartStart. The first time the server is configured, the
SmartStart program automatically creates a necessary partition on your hard
drive. This partition cannot be used for any other purpose and is not a
traditional system partition.
Follow this sequence when installing your operating system for the first time:
1. Review all guidelines listed from the beginning of this chapter through
the “Locating Materials” section.
2. Install any hardware options. See Chapter 3, “Hardware Options
Installation,” or the option kits, for detailed instructions on installing
internal hardware.
3. Connect the power cord and any peripheral devices. See Chapter 1,
“Server Features,” for the location of all rear panel connectors.
WARNING: To reduce the risk of electric shock or fire, do not plug
telecommunications/telephone connectors into the network interface
controller (NIC) receptacle.
